This accountancy program provides a comprehensive curriculum spanning four years, designed to equip students with foundational and advanced knowledge in accounting and related business disciplines. Starting with core courses in English, history, science, and business fundamentals, students progressively delve into financial and managerial accounting, business law, analytics, finance, marketing, and management. The coursework emphasizes both practical skills and strategic understanding, preparing students for professional roles in the accounting sector. Throughout the program, students will develop expertise in accounting information systems, auditing, income tax, cost accounting, and accounting analytics, culminating in a strategic management course. The curriculum also incorporates professional development components to enhance career readiness.

To complete the program, students must accumulate a total of 123 credit hours, including core courses, electives, and professional development components. The curriculum spans four years, with specified courses in each year—ranging from introductory subjects to advanced accounting topics and management courses—culminating in strategic management and professional development modules.

Graduates of this accountancy program are well-prepared for careers in accounting, auditing, financial analysis, tax consultancy, and management accounting. The comprehensive coursework, especially in accounting analytics, information systems, and auditing, positions students for roles in accounting firms, corporations, or public agencies seeking skilled financial professionals.
